Next came the exploration of fundamental flavors. The "five flavors" – sweet, sour, salty, bitter, and spicy – aren't merely a theoretical concept in Chinese cuisine; they’re a practical framework for balancing and harmonizing tastes. Chris meticulously studied the ways in which these flavors interact, learning how a touch of sweetness can elevate the savory depth of a stir-fry, or how a hint of bitterness can cut through the richness of a braised dish. This understanding transformed the act of cooking from a mere process into a creative endeavor, allowing Chris to build layers of complexity and depth in each dish.
The exploration extended beyond the basic principles. Chris delved into regional variations, discovering the stark differences between the delicate flavors of Cantonese cuisine and the bold, spicy notes of Sichuan. Cantonese dishes, often characterized by their lighter sauces and emphasis on freshness, provided a stark contrast to the fiery heat and complex aromatics of Sichuan peppercorns and chili oil that define Sichuan cuisine. Chris learned to appreciate the subtle nuances of each regional style, recognizing that "Chinese food" isn't a monolithic entity but a vast tapestry woven from countless regional traditions.
